About the job: Business Analyst (Healthcare)

Position(s) are available at both an Associate level (3 years relevant experience) and a Senior level (8+ years experience).

Job purpose: Understand business requirements and, through structured process documentation, validate and translate them into functional specifications used by technical experts to craft analytical solutions.

Ensure robust process and business documentation is maintained and updated in line with product roadmaps.

Build strong relationships across teams involved in analytical delivery.

Core responsibilities include:

  1. Facilitate the development of a business case by working with analytical product owners.
  2. Document and understand client requirements using the Customer Requirements Specification (CRS).
  3. Design and validate functional solutions by interpreting the CRS into Product Requirements Specifications (PRS).
  4. Demonstrate GUI prototypes to validate designs.
  5. Propose solutions by reviewing approved CRS and PRS.
  6. Assist project managers and owners by updating and reporting on progress and managing delivery; conduct Post Implementation Reviews (PIR) if required.
  7. Ensure testing of solutions by applying the test basket.
  8. Update and publish release notes related to changes; maintain and update all related documentation; perform live monitoring during go-live.
  9. Respond to incidents and conduct preliminary analysis of issues.
  10. Document the SLA.
  11. Participate in internal delivery forums.

What you need to be successful:

Behavioral skills: Communication skills across stakeholders, ability to work cohesively in a team, high attention to detail, resilience, enthusiasm, positive attitude, and ability to give and receive feedback.

Technical understanding: Knowledge of healthcare analytics tools, informatics, healthcare technology, data science, clinical tools, healthcare reporting, healthcare benefit pricing, and fraud and operations environment.

Qualifications: Informatics or relevant degree (Honours preferred); experience in healthcare technology is advantageous.
